Viticulture and Enology Research Seminar Registration Deadline Nearing

Washington State winegrape growers and wineries must act soon to reserve a seat at the third annual Washington Advancements in Viticulture and Enology (WAVE) seminar on April 4 at the Clore Center in Prosser. The day-long event, sponsored by the Washington State Wine Commission and Washington State University, highlights the latest research and findings supported by the Washington wine industry.

Advertisement

Vineyard research topics include:

  • Assessing New Sprayer Technologies
  • Irrigating White Winegrape Varieties
  • How to Manage Salinity and Sodicity in Vineyard Soil and Irrigation Water
  • Is Red Blotch Virus in Washington Vineyards?

Winery research topics include:

  • Managing Wine Spoilage in the Cellar
  • Understanding and Managing Astringency in Red Wine
  • Learning About Smoke Taint

The goal of WAVE is to raise awareness about the value of research among grape growers and wineries. The research seminars have become a valuable venue to discuss current and future research and bring scientists and industry members together. The first two WAVEs have been sell-out events.
